The Xiaomi X Pro 75 Inch QLED 4K Smart TV delivers a premium cinematic experience through its expansive 189 cm display. Featuring advanced Quantum Dot technology, the screen produces over a billion colors with 94 percent DCI-P3 color gamut coverage, ensuring vibrant and life-like visuals. This television supports high-end imaging standards including Dolby Vision, HDR10+, and HLG, further enhanced by a dedicated Filmmaker Mode that preserves the director’s original creative intent. With a bezel-less design and a 97.76 percent screen-to-body ratio, the display offers an immersive, near-borderless viewing area suitable for any modern living space.
Performance is driven by a powerful quad-core A55 processor coupled with 2GB of RAM and 32GB of internal storage, providing a smooth interface for the integrated Google TV operating system. The Xiaomi X Pro 75 Inch QLED 4K Smart TV is equipped with Dual Line Gate 120Hz technology and Reality Flow MEMC to ensure fluid motion during fast-paced sports and action sequences. For gamers, the inclusion of Auto Low Latency Mode and a specialized 120Hz Game Booster reduces input lag, while the dual-band Wi-Fi and Bluetooth 5.0 connectivity options allow for seamless integration with external peripherals and high-speed internet.
The audio system consists of 34W speakers tuned with Xiaomi Sound, supporting Dolby Audio, DTS:X, and DTS Virtual:X to create a three-dimensional soundstage. Beyond its hardware, the Xiaomi X Pro 75 Inch QLED 4K Smart TV features the PatchWall interface, which provides curated content recommendations and access to over 30 free live channels via Xiaomi TV+. Users can interact with the device hands-free using Google Assistant or cast content directly from mobile devices using built-in Chromecast and Apple AirPlay 2 support. Physical connectivity is robust, offering three HDMI ports with eARC support, two USB ports, and an optical port for comprehensive home theater setups.

The Xiaomi 75-inch X Pro Series QLED TV offers an impressive 4K UHD viewing experience with good resolution, high-quality sound, and a comprehensive set of modern features at a competitive price point that represents excellent value for money. While the product itself is highly regarded for its performance and overall quality, the ownership experience is significantly marred by poor after-sales support, specifically involving a lack of timely installation after delivery and broken promises from the setup team. Additionally, users may find the sound and picture customization options somewhat restrictive, and there are serious concerns regarding unresponsive customer service and the absence of promised extended warranty documentation. Television Dimensions and Weight Specifications

A technical product graphic displays the physical specifications of a large flat-screen television from two different angles. On the left, a front-facing view shows a slim-bezel display with a vibrant, abstract floral pattern in shades of blue and pink. The screen measures 1668mm in width and 959mm in height. To the right, a side-profile view highlights the thinness of the screen at 76mm, while the total height including the stand is 1027mm, and the depth of the stand base is 391mm. The bottom of the image provides weight data, noting that the unit weighs 18.7KG without the base and has a total shipping weight of 29.2KG including packing materials.
